| Biography: |
| Josh Robinson is a talented two-way player who finished his junior season with 14 catches for 245 yards and two scores on offense (nine total). On defense, he had 25 tackles and two picks. He says he benches 225-pounds and has a 34-inch vertical jump. Robinson has a 21-foot long jump and runs the 100m (10.52) and the 200m (21.14). He wants to run track in college.
Robinson says he wants to major in criminal justice and reports a 2.4 core GPA and an 810 SAT and 18 ACT. "My GPA last semester was a 3.4 and I've got a 3.7 now, so my grades will be going up."
Robinson: "I have the ability to make plays. I have a great burst and good speed. I can break tackles well too. I'm also pretty strong and am always moving my feet.
"But I'd like to improve my hands and catch better. I also need better vision and awareness on the field.
"I love having the ball in my hands, but also love to hit. So I don't really care if I play receiver or corner."
